Ingredients:  
Ingredients:  
1 1/2 lb. ground beef or ground turkey
9 strips of pre-cooked bacon, re-cooked to well done in microwave, broken up into bite size pieces
1 large onion, chopped
48 oz. Great Northern mixed beans, drained
2 small cans Campbells Pork and Beans
1 cup catsup
1 cup packed brown sugar
1/2 cup white sugar
1 tbls. wine vinegar
1/2 tbls. minced garlic

Directions:
Directions:
Brown meat, onion and garlic. Combine all ingredients in covered casserole and bake at 350 degrees for 45 minutes, or slow cook in crock pot for 4 hours on low.
